The following project work investigates and discusses the main features related to the Industrial IoT paradigm from the viewpoint of a global leader in measurement instrumentation, services and solutions for industrial process engineering which, through the Industrial IoT-enabled platform of its property, aspires to strengthen its competitive position in the served markets, especially those majorly suffering from increasing cost-pressure. After a review of the Industrial IoT market’s prevailing trends, confirmed benefits and opportunities, and most important adoption challenges and barriers, the competitive advantage the company seeks was developed via the design of Industrial IoT use cases in specific target industries. The use cases were drawn from i) a previous analysis on the most sought-after use cases related to the Industrial IoT concept; ii) the use cases developed by traditional competitors and players driving the market; iii) from the study and analysis of processes of the target industries; and iv) from collaboration of different branches and functions of the company. The results of this process were bundled with the development of a prioritization framework and a roadmap for implementation of the use cases. Finally, feedback on the strategic orientation of the company were delivered in order to be more aligned to the Industrial IoT paradigm, mainly focusing on i) the strategic role of the sensor data and of the platform; ii) the integration of the new and former businesses; iii) the analysis of the customer profile; iv) the partnership network; v) the transformations in the business model; and vi) the operating model of the company.
